Kripto Sözlük

Blok Zinciri Konsensüs Algoritmaları Nedir?

Banner Reklam

Blok zinciri teknolojisi içerisinde kullanılan konsensüs algoritmaları, bir grup veya sistem içerisinde uzlaşma sağlanması için kullanılan yöntemlerdir. Bu algoritmalar, katılımcılar arasında anlaşmazlıkları çözmek ve yeni verileri sisteme eklemek için kullanılır. Blok zinciri ağlarında, doğru ve güvenilir bir şekilde yeni blokların eklenmesi için konsensüs algoritmaları gereklidir. Bu algoritmalar, ağın güvenliğini sağlamak, çift harcamayı önlemek ve merkezi olmayan bir yapıyı sürdürülebilir kılmak için önemlidir.

Konsensüs Algoritmalarının Önemi: Konsensüs algoritmaları, blok zinciri teknolojisinin temel prensiplerini destekler. Bu algoritmalar, merkezi bir otoriteye ihtiyaç duymadan katılımcıların uzlaşmasını sağlayarak güvenliği ve bütünlüğü temin eder. Blok zinciri ağlarındaki kullanıcılar arasında güvenilir ve adil bir işbirliğini mümkün kılar. Ayrıca, enerji tüketimini azaltabilir, işlem hızını artırabilir ve işlem ücretlerini düşürebilir.

Konsensüs Algoritmaları Türleri ve Özellikleri:

  1. Proof of Work (PoW – İş Kanıtı): Bu algoritma, ağdaki katılımcıların belirli matematiksel problemleri çözerek işlem yapmalarını gerektirir. Problemleri çözmek zor olduğundan, işlemcilerin büyük bir hesaplama gücüne ihtiyaç duymasıyla enerji yoğun bir algoritmaya dönüşebilir. Bitcoin bu algoritmayı kullanır.
  2. Proof of Stake (PoS – Hisse Kanıtı): PoS, kullanıcıların kripto varlıklarını ağın güvenliğini sağlamak için kullanmalarını gerektirir. Kullanıcılar varlıklarını “stake” ederek işlem doğrulama hakları kazanır ve ödüller alır. Enerji tasarruflu bir algoritmadır. Ethereum 2.0, Cardano gibi projelerde kullanılmaktadır.
  3. Proof of Burn: Bu algoritma, katılımcıların kripto varlıklarını yakarak (imha ederek) blok oluşturma hakları kazanmalarını sağlar. Yakılan kripto varlıklarının miktarı, blok oluşturma yetkisi kazanma oranını belirler.
  4. Proof of History: Proof of History, blok zinciri ağının işlem sırasını ve zamanlamasını sağlamak için kullanılır. İşlem sıralamasını belirlemek için önceden hesaplanmış bir zaman damgası kullanır. Bu sayede ağın hızlı çalışması ve güvenliği artırılır. Solana projesinde kullanılmaktadır.
  5. Proof of Authority: Bu algoritma, ağdaki doğrulayıcıların kimlik ve itibarına dayanır. Önceden doğrulanan kullanıcılar blok üretme yetkisi kazanır. Enerji verimli ve hızlı işlem yapma kabiliyetine sahiptir.

Konsensüs Algoritmaları ve Blok zinciri Teknolojisi

Konsensüs algoritmaları, bir topluluğun veya sistemin uzlaşması için temel gerekliliklerden biridir. Bu algoritmalar, blok zinciri teknolojisinin merkeziyetsiz yapısının temel taşıdır. Blok zincirindeki verilerin güvenilir bir şekilde kaydedilmesi ve işlemlerin onaylanması için bu algoritmalar kullanılır. İşte farklı konsensüs algoritmalarının ana hatları:

Proof of Work (PoW)

PoW, Bitcoin gibi kriptopara ağlarında yaygın olarak kullanılır. Katılımcılar, karmaşık matematiksel problemleri çözerek blokları onaylar. Bu algoritma enerji yoğun olabilir ve yüksek işlem ücretleriyle ilişkilendirilebilir.

Proof of Stake (PoS)

PoS, kullanıcıların kripto varlıklarını “stake” ederek ağı güvence altına almasını sağlar. Daha fazla stake, daha fazla blok onaylama hakkı anlamına gelir. PoS enerji tasarruflu bir alternatiftir ve Ethereum 2.0 gibi projelerde kullanılmaktadır.

Proof of Burn

Bu algoritma, katılımcıların kripto varlıklarını yakarak blok oluşturma hakkı elde etmelerine dayanır. Yakılan varlık miktarı, blok üretme yetkisini belirler.

Proof of History

Proof of History, Solana gibi ağlarda kullanılır. İşlem sırasını ve zamanlamasını önceden hesaplanmış bir zaman damgasıyla sağlayarak ağın hızını ve güvenliğini artırır.

Proof of Authority

Bu algoritma, kimlik ve itibara dayalıdır. Doğrulayıcılar, kripto varlıklarını değil, kimlik ve itibarlarını kullanarak blokları onaylar. Hızlı işlem yapma kabiliyetine ve düşük işlem ücretlerine sahiptir.

Konsensüs algoritmaları, blok zinciri teknolojisinin dayandığı temel prensipleri sağlayarak güvenilir, merkezi olmayan ve verimli bir sistem oluşturmayı amaçlar. Her bir algoritma, farklı avantajları ve dezavantajlarıyla öne çıkar.

Banner Reklam

Muhammed AKAN

Bir mühendis, bir teknoloji manyağı ve bir mükemmeliyet tutkunu. Teknoloji hayranlığının ideal kombinasyonu. Ben Muhammed Akan, iyi bir ülkede iyi bir eğitim aldım. 2016'nın son çeyreğinden 2020'nin Haziran ayına kadar Google Mühendisi olarak çalıştım. Bu unvan ile birçok devlet kurumuna web güvenlik semineri verdim. Şu an üniversite öğrencisi olarak eğitim hayatıma devam ediyorum. İlgimi çeken konular hakkında akademik düzeyde araştırma yapıyor, araştırdıklarımı okuyor, düşünüyor, yazıyor ve paylaşıyorum.

Bir yanıt yazın

E-posta adresiniz yayınl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ir

Göz Atın
Kapalı
Çerez Bildirimi